Andy Lawrence (musician)
Andy Lawrence (born November 2, 1954 in Swindon ) is a composer and musician from Great Britain.
Life
Andy Lawrence comes from a family of musicians. At the age of eleven he received trumpet lessons from Frank Goff of the Edinburgh Symphony Orchestra . At the age of 17 he played in the American soul band The Fantastics . He toured Europe and Asia with the Roy Pellet Jazz Band for five years before settling in West Berlin . There he was a freelance artist and studio musician, but also worked as a composer and arranger. In 1984 he moved to Baden-Württemberg , where he taught the brass section of the Baden-Württemberg Youth Jazz Orchestra. Lawrence became the busiest trumpeter in southern Germany in the traditional style and performed with all the well-known southern German Dixieland and jazz bands . At times he led his own big band .
Andy Lawrence plays the trumpet, cornet and flugelhorn and also appears as a singer.
Lawrence was or is a member of Lindfors' Swing Affairs , Miss Mayer's Hinterhausjazzer , the New Storyville Jazzband , the Louis Prima Revival Band , the Louis Armstrong Revival Band , Joe Wulf & his Orchestra , Simply Swing , Peter Bühr & his Flatfoot Stompers and The Chicagoans .
